Location is the best thing about it as you can gamble at the Venetian, Palazzo and Wynn without paying the higher room rates.Loved the location for treasure island. I think what I liked the most about it was ease of access for the car. I despise having to drive on the strip and I hate when you have to drive up and around 7 floors to get a spot. Treasure island isn't really a target destination for people to drive to and park at so there was always parking easily available on floor three which was really the main floor and first one you enter on. It was really easy to get in and out of to head around town too, no drunk pedestrians to deal with.
